天堂国产午夜亚洲专区-少妇人妻综合久久蜜臀-国产成人户外露出视频在线-国产91传媒一区二区三区

基于DPDK的高速網(wǎng)絡(luò)存儲(chǔ)優(yōu)化技術(shù)研究

發(fā)布時(shí)間:2021-07-05 13:41
  隨著對(duì)大數(shù)據(jù)與人工智能等新型技術(shù)領(lǐng)域的研究,使得互聯(lián)網(wǎng)企業(yè)的數(shù)據(jù)中心服務(wù)規(guī)模呈現(xiàn)激增的趨勢(shì)。在當(dāng)下的高速網(wǎng)絡(luò)環(huán)境下,為網(wǎng)絡(luò)數(shù)據(jù)存儲(chǔ)和分析帶來(lái)了新的問(wèn)題。從數(shù)據(jù)存儲(chǔ)方式角度出發(fā),隨著云網(wǎng)絡(luò)的逐步普及化,使得關(guān)系型數(shù)據(jù)庫(kù)在處理速率上無(wú)法與數(shù)據(jù)接收速率保持一致,導(dǎo)致程序在執(zhí)行過(guò)程中出現(xiàn)數(shù)據(jù)丟失現(xiàn)象。從存儲(chǔ)配置角度出發(fā),大型數(shù)據(jù)存儲(chǔ)運(yùn)行前都需要進(jìn)行大量參數(shù)配置,而且采用人工配置或默認(rèn)配置會(huì)使得性能無(wú)法適應(yīng)環(huán)境變化,導(dǎo)致數(shù)據(jù)庫(kù)無(wú)法發(fā)揮正常存儲(chǔ)水平。本文針對(duì)于DPDK(Data Plane Development Kit)環(huán)境下高速網(wǎng)絡(luò)存儲(chǔ)優(yōu)化研究,主要做了以下三個(gè)方面的工作:首先,針對(duì)基于DPDK下內(nèi)存數(shù)據(jù)庫(kù)存儲(chǔ)所存在的速率不一致問(wèn)題,提出基于管道的多批次并行存儲(chǔ)優(yōu)化方法,在底層DPDK的支撐下實(shí)現(xiàn)高速網(wǎng)絡(luò)數(shù)據(jù)的緩存操作。該方法實(shí)現(xiàn)通過(guò)利用接收端擴(kuò)展技術(shù)與數(shù)據(jù)分發(fā)技術(shù)實(shí)現(xiàn)數(shù)據(jù)的預(yù)處理,將當(dāng)下單隊(duì)列單CPU執(zhí)行轉(zhuǎn)變?yōu)槎嚓?duì)列多CPU運(yùn)行。并且綜合考慮數(shù)據(jù)存儲(chǔ)過(guò)程中,數(shù)據(jù)接收和數(shù)據(jù)存儲(chǔ)批次大小的差異問(wèn)題,再將DPDK的突發(fā)接收與Redis的Pipeline結(jié)合,減少數(shù)據(jù)存儲(chǔ)過(guò)程中處理量差異,提升網(wǎng)絡(luò)數(shù)... 

【文章來(lái)源】:南京郵電大學(xué)江蘇省

【文章頁(yè)數(shù)】:80 頁(yè)

【學(xué)位級(jí)別】:碩士

【部分圖文】:

基于DPDK的高速網(wǎng)絡(luò)存儲(chǔ)優(yōu)化技術(shù)研究


批次處理延遲對(duì)比

吞吐量,數(shù)據(jù)包,性能


南京郵電大學(xué)專(zhuān)業(yè)學(xué)位碩士研究生學(xué)位論文第三章基于管道的多批次并行數(shù)據(jù)存儲(chǔ)優(yōu)化31圖3.11不同數(shù)據(jù)包大小下I/O吞吐量性能對(duì)比在網(wǎng)絡(luò)通信中在大規(guī)模流量下單個(gè)數(shù)據(jù)包大小會(huì)直接影響吞吐量高低,通過(guò)圖示3.11可以看出Single-Batch在小包下吞吐量相對(duì)較低,Smart-Batch由于需要?jiǎng)討B(tài)進(jìn)行調(diào)節(jié)所以需要一定的I/O成本,三者在數(shù)據(jù)包大小為512bytes后吞吐量差距較小且都保持在10Mpps以上,而Mp-Batch在64bytes和1024bytes都能保持吞吐量9.7Mpps以上,體現(xiàn)出對(duì)于Mp-Batch算法進(jìn)行存儲(chǔ)的優(yōu)越性。圖3.12Batch對(duì)存儲(chǔ)性能影響

性能,吞吐量,數(shù)據(jù)包,專(zhuān)業(yè)學(xué)位


南京郵電大學(xué)專(zhuān)業(yè)學(xué)位碩士研究生學(xué)位論文第三章基于管道的多批次并行數(shù)據(jù)存儲(chǔ)優(yōu)化31圖3.11不同數(shù)據(jù)包大小下I/O吞吐量性能對(duì)比在網(wǎng)絡(luò)通信中在大規(guī)模流量下單個(gè)數(shù)據(jù)包大小會(huì)直接影響吞吐量高低,通過(guò)圖示3.11可以看出Single-Batch在小包下吞吐量相對(duì)較低,Smart-Batch由于需要?jiǎng)討B(tài)進(jìn)行調(diào)節(jié)所以需要一定的I/O成本,三者在數(shù)據(jù)包大小為512bytes后吞吐量差距較小且都保持在10Mpps以上,而Mp-Batch在64bytes和1024bytes都能保持吞吐量9.7Mpps以上,體現(xiàn)出對(duì)于Mp-Batch算法進(jìn)行存儲(chǔ)的優(yōu)越性。圖3.12Batch對(duì)存儲(chǔ)性能影響

【參考文獻(xiàn)】:
期刊論文
[1]基于強(qiáng)化學(xué)習(xí)的Lustre文件系統(tǒng)的性能調(diào)優(yōu)[J]. 張文韜,汪璐,程耀東.  計(jì)算機(jī)研究與發(fā)展. 2019(07)
[2]基于PF_RING的高速網(wǎng)絡(luò)數(shù)據(jù)捕獲方法[J]. 吳克河,王冬冬.  計(jì)算機(jī)與數(shù)字工程. 2019(03)
[3]An SDN/NFV Based Framework for Management and Deployment of Service Based 5G Core Network[J]. Lu Ma,Xiangming Wen,Luhan Wang,Zhaoming Lu,Raymond Knopp.  中國(guó)通信. 2018(10)
[4]一種云存儲(chǔ)環(huán)境下的資源調(diào)度改進(jìn)算法[J]. 徐建鵬,李欣,趙曉凡.  計(jì)算機(jī)應(yīng)用研究. 2019(07)
[5]基于OpenStack的云計(jì)算網(wǎng)絡(luò)性能測(cè)量與分析[J]. 王小艷,陳興蜀,王毅桐,葛龍.  山東大學(xué)學(xué)報(bào)(理學(xué)版). 2018(01)
[6]基于Zabbix的網(wǎng)絡(luò)監(jiān)控系統(tǒng)[J]. 趙哲,譚海波,趙赫,王衛(wèi)東,李曉風(fēng).  計(jì)算機(jī)技術(shù)與發(fā)展. 2018(01)

博士論文
[1]非關(guān)系型數(shù)據(jù)存儲(chǔ)與管理系統(tǒng)性能優(yōu)化研究與實(shí)現(xiàn)[D]. 鮑先強(qiáng).國(guó)防科學(xué)技術(shù)大學(xué) 2016

碩士論文
[1]基于內(nèi)存數(shù)據(jù)庫(kù)Redis的眾包系統(tǒng)性能優(yōu)化[D]. 李詩(shī)云.浙江大學(xué) 2016
[2]高可用可擴(kuò)展集群化Redis設(shè)計(jì)與實(shí)現(xiàn)[D]. 閆明.西安電子科技大學(xué) 2014



本文編號(hào):3266174

資料下載
論文發(fā)表

本文鏈接:http://sikaile.net/kejilunwen/shengwushengchang/3266174.html


Copyright(c)文論論文網(wǎng)All Rights Reserved | 網(wǎng)站地圖 |

版權(quán)申明:資料由用戶(hù)a6c9b***提供,本站僅收錄摘要或目錄,作者需要?jiǎng)h除請(qǐng)E-mail郵箱bigeng88@qq.com